H.B. 1480 Summary

  • Authorizes the state fire council to use money from the reduced ignition propensity cigarette program special fund for statewide fire prevention, education, life safety, and preparedness programs targeting youth, seniors, and persons with disabilities.

  • Maintains existing use of the special fund to administer and enforce the reduced ignition propensity cigarette program, including employing a full-time administrator and assistant.

  • Permits the state fire council to hire additional administrative personnel to oversee statewide fire data collection, analysis, and federal fire-related grant administration using special fund moneys.

  • Takes effect upon approval.
